Transaction 9643be8863954e6279c3d80b535c8800439326845c87962deaa2bfbc2d228061
1 Input
1 Output
-
9643be8863954e6279c3d80b535c8800439326845c87962deaa2bfbc2d228061:0
- value
- 513524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64fa84077746ac6ee1a9b445e3c4a91a93c8ff8e OP_EQUAL
- address
- 3Atwbs9kPBPgo3jufVSyZ6BMSgg3nHEfyp